.map-container[data-v-78921a82]{width:500px;height:400px;min-height:400px}.popup-box{background:#fff;padding:10px 15px;border-radius:6px;box-shadow:0 2px 10px rgba(0,0,0,.15);min-width:150px;text-align:center}.popup-title{font-size:16px;font-weight:700;margin-bottom:5px;color:#1890ff}.popup-count{font-size:14px;color:#333;margin-bottom:5px}.popup-details{font-size:12px;color:#666;margin-bottom:5px}.popup-type{font-size:12px;color:#999;padding-top:5px;border-top:1px solid #eee}